This is a list of the top 25 interest groups giving campaign contributions to this Member of Congress in 2008, the most recent year for which we have a full data set.

Interest GroupAmount Received
Attorneys & law firms$567,286
Employer listed but category unknown$432,738
Retired$403,890
Pro-Israel$275,428
Democratic/Liberal$168,197
Real Estate developers & subdividers$105,950
Schools & colleges$98,950
Real estate$95,175
Auto manufacturers$93,550
Lobbyists & Public Relations$87,774
Investors$78,490
Homemakers, students & other non-income earners$76,450
Security brokers & investment companies$70,650
Trial Lawyers & law firms$67,650
General commerce$64,800
No employer listed or discovered$55,550
Transfer from intermediary ( type 24I or 24T)$47,460
Hospitals$46,629
Civil servant/public employee$46,250
Business services$45,483
Real estate agents$42,925
Physicians$42,300
Security services$39,350
Defense electronic contractors$37,800
Gas & Electric Utilities$37,550
